Information about the Blue Morpho Butterfly:
The Blue Morpho Butterfly lives in rainforests of South and Central America. It is has brilliant blue wings. It is a neo-tropical butterfly with has a wingspan of about 6 inches (15 cm). The vivid color of the blue morpho’s wings is a result of the microscopic scales on the backs of their wings, which reflect light, causing the butterfly to appear a brilliant iridescent blue.

Artist’s notes:
This drawing of a Blue Morpho was created in 2007. It was a challenge to capture the iridescence of the wings without making it look artificial. The color of these butterflies really is striking. I saw a few in the rainforests of Costa Rica. When they are resting they fold up their wings and are hard to see in the forest undergrowth. But when they’re disturbed they ‘pop’ up with a brilliant flash of metallic blue.
